The radino series combine a microcontroller with a RF transceiver in a small form factor.
- The radino based on a Atmel ATmega32U4 (same as Arduino Leonardo and Arduino Micro)
- The radino32 based on a STMicroelectronics STM32L1
- The radinoL4 based on a STMicroelectronics STM32L4

Here is an overview to our radino product family and suitable development boards.
Board | Pictures | Description |
---|---|---|
radinoL4 DW1000 | for Ranging and RTLS, Ultra Wideband (UWB), IEEE802.15.4-2011 compliant, 3.5-6.5GHz,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ino32 DW1000 | for Ranging and RTLS, Ultra Wideband (UWB), IEEE802.15.4-2011 compliant, 3.5-6.5GHz,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ino32 WiFi | 802.11 b/g/n, integrated TCP/IP protocol stack,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ino32 nRF8001 | Bluetooth v4.0 compliant,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ino32 CC1101 | integrated CC1101 HF frontend for 433-925MHz,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ino32 SX1272 | long range transmission up to 30 km, 23 GPIOS, I²C, SPI, 2xUART, USB | |
radino WiFi | 802.11 b/g/n, integrated TCP/IP protocol stack, 15 GPIOS, I²C, SPI, UART, USB HID | |
radino nRF8001 | Bluetooth v4.0 compliant, 15 GPIOS, I²C, SPI, UART, USB HID | |
radino CC1101 | integrated CC1101 HF frontend for 433/868/915MHz, 15 GPIOS, I²C, SPI, UART, USB HID | |
radino RF69 | integrated RF69 HF frontend for 433/868MHz, 15 GPIOS, I²C, SPI, UART, USB HID | |
radino RF233 | integrated RF233 HF frontend for 2.4GHz, 15 GPIOS, I²C, SPI, UART, USB HID | |
radino Leonardo | Carrier board suitable for all radino modules. Includes Arduino connector for easy mounting of Arduino shields. Voltage regulator and Level-Shifters are also included. | |
radino Spider 2.4G | Breadboard adapter for all radino modules | |
radino USB Stick | USB Stick for all radino modules. Available with integrated Chip-antennas and as a version with RP-SMA-connector. | |
radino UART-Bridge | UART bridge with power supply and level shifters for all radino modules | |
radino RS485/RS232-Bridge IP65 | radino RS485-Bridge IP65 outdoor radio adapter for Modbus, Art-Net etc. Includes RS485 driver, RS232 driver, IP65 enclosure. | |
XBee-PRO Shield | XBee Pro adapter for all radino modules | |
radino DinRail Adapter | DinRail Adapter connects our RS485 DinRail Bus System to radino modules |
